The French Skincare Routine
1. Keep Everything Gentle
French skincare begins with one non-negotiable principle. Never be harsh with your skin.
French skincare is rooted in gentleness, so your products and the way you use them need to be gentle too.
Now, how do you get in sync with this rule? I’d start with cleanser first.
If you use something that feels drying or leaves your skin feeling squeaky clean, then it’s a sign to switch to a gentle cleanser.
Micellar water or cleansing milk are good choices that most French women go for.
After cleansing, always pat your skin dry with a soft face towel instead of rubbing it with just any towel.
Apply all your products with light upward strokes (no scrubbing like a madwoman). If a product stings or burns, stop using it immediately.
If you use alcohol-based toner, um, then don’t. Pick a hydrating essence or thermal water spray instead.
Lastly, choose cream and lotion formulas over gels if you have sensitive skin.
2. Perfect Your Three-Step Foundation Skincare

We’re pretty early into this guide, but it must be clear by now that French women swear by simplicity.
Their base skincare routine revolves around three essential steps that you can master in under 10 minutes each morning and evening.
In the morning, cleanse with micellar water on a cotton pad, hydrate with a lightweight moisturizer or facial oil, and protect with SPF 30 or higher (non-negotiable, babe).
In the nighttime, double cleanse your skin, first with an oil or balm, then with your gentle cleanser.
Then treat your skin treat with a serum targeting your specific concerns (retinol, vitamin C, or niacinamide). And lastly, nourish with a richer night moisturizer or facial oil.
Three steps, and nothing more than that. Simple, easy, and it’s all your skin needs to breathe and function well.
3. Embrace Your Skin’s Natural Cycle
One of the reasons I love French skincare is that it doesn’t make you fight your skin, you know. It actually gets your skin to work with its own natural rhythms and needs.
You can do this by simply paying attention to how your skin feels and responds to different conditions.
First, we have to talk about the weather, of course. In spring, you might introduce gentle exfoliation with lactic acid to help your skin recover from winter dryness.
Summer calls for lightweight hydration and diligent sun protection, while fall is the perfect time to add nourishing oils as the weather begins to change.
Winter requires layering hydrating products and also using a humidifier to combat dry indoor air.
During your menstrual cycle, when hormonal fluctuations can make skin more sensitive, scale back on active ingredients and focus on gentle products instead.
When you’re feeling overwhelmed or haven’t been sleeping well, add an extra hydrating step to your routine and use a face mask.
4. Master the Art of French Pharmacy Shopping

French pharmacies are treasure troves of effective and affordable skincare that locals have relied on for generations.
Adopting French skincare means trying out their pharmacy brands, because that’s what women over there use on daily basis.
These are the must-try French pharmacy brands:
- La Roche-Posay: Perfect for sensitive skin and they have excellent SPF options
- Avène: Thermal water products ideal for reactive skin
- Vichy: Mineral-rich formulations for all skin types
- Caudalie: Grape-based antioxidants for a natural glow
- Nuxe: Luxurious oils and honey-based treatments
Don’t commit to a new routine at once. Begin with one product from a line to see how your skin responds. This won’t overwhelm your skin or your wallet.
You can ask the pharmacist for recommendations based on your specific skin concerns, as they’re trained professionals who understand these products inside and out.
Always read ingredient lists and choose products with minimal ingredients that you recognize and know your skin can actually benefit from.
And yes, always invest in a quality SPF and gentle cleanser first before experimenting with treatment products, as these form the foundation of any effective routine (as we learnt in tip no.2).

6. Build Your French Girl Lifestyle

For French women, skincare extends far beyond their bathroom routine, and includes everything from what they eat and drink to how they manage stress and prioritize rest.
This holistic approach is what gives them the natural radiance that you just cannot get with products alone.
If you want a French glow-up, then you’d need to build daily habits that nourish your skin from the inside.
The best place to start would be your hydration. Start drinking water consistently throughout the day rather than waiting until you feel thirsty.
Every night, go to bed at the same time, and sleep for 7-8 hours without any disturbance. And try waking up early enough to get some morning sunlight on your skin.
Fill your diet with fresh fruits, vegetables, and healthy fats like those found in olive oil, avocados, and fish.
And please, for the love of your gut and skin, limit sugar and processed foods. They really can trigger inflammation and breakouts and I can vouch for this from one too many pizza nights.
At last, do not underestimate the power of stress management, my friend.
A cluttered and anxious mind can really mess with your skin and show up in the form of pimples and dark circles.
Go for walks to clear your head, meditate in the morning, relax with long baths, and do whatever you gotta to unwind and relax.
